Software Developer Jobs in Miami: Frequently Asked Questions

How do I get a software developer job in Miami?

Focus your search on Miami's fintech corridor in Brickell, the healthtech companies in the Health District, and the growing startup scene in Wynwood. Mid-size software firms and Latin American regional headquarters of global tech companies hire consistently here. Fluency in Spanish is a genuine advantage with many Miami employers, and experience in financial platforms or healthcare systems will make you a stronger candidate locally.

Are there remote software developer jobs in Miami?

Yes, software development is one of the more remote-friendly disciplines because the core work is screen-based and asynchronous. About 50% of software developer openings tied to Miami are remote or hybrid as of July 2026, with back-end, cloud, and full-stack roles most likely to offer full flexibility. On-site expectations tend to be higher at Miami fintech firms and hospital system roles that require proximity to internal teams.

How can I get a software developer job in Miami with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path in Miami is targeting QA engineer, junior full-stack, or associate developer roles at mid-size fintech and healthtech companies, which hire entry-level candidates more consistently than large enterprises. Miami's startup ecosystem in Wynwood and the Design District offers junior roles where candidates can build breadth quickly. A portfolio with projects relevant to financial tools, payments, or healthcare data stands out to local hiring managers.
